Share via


IShellFolderView::RefreshObject-Methode (shlobj_core.h)

[RefreshObject ist für die Verwendung in den im Abschnitt Anforderungen angegebenen Betriebssystemen verfügbar. Sie kann in nachfolgenden Versionen geändert oder nicht verfügbar sein.]

Zeichnet das angegebene Element neu.

Syntax

HRESULT RefreshObject(
  [in]  PUITEMID_CHILD pidl,
  [out] UINT           *puItem
);

Parameter

[in] pidl

Typ: PUITEMID_CHILD

Das element, das neu gezeichnet werden soll.

[out] puItem

Typ: UINT*

Ein Zeiger auf einen Wert, der den Index des neu gezeichneten Elements empfängt, wenn diese Methode erfolgreich zurückgibt. Sie können diesen Wert verwenden, um IShellFolderView::GetObject aufzurufen, um die PITEMID_CHILD abzurufen, die Sie gerade neu gezeichnet haben.

Rückgabewert

Typ: HRESULT

Wenn diese Methode erfolgreich ist, wird S_OK zurückgegeben. Andernfalls wird ein Fehlercode HRESULT zurückgegeben.

Hinweise

Wenn Sie IShellFolderView::GetObject sofort mit dem von puItem zurückgegebenen Index aufrufen, erhalten Sie eine Kopie der ITEMID_CHILD, die Sie neu wiederherstellen. Die Indexposition eines Elements kann sich jedoch im Laufe der Zeit ändern, sodass code nicht darauf vertrauen kann, dass ein bestimmter Index immer denselben ITEMID_CHILD zurückgibt.

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client) Windows XP [nur Desktop-Apps]
Unterstützte Mindestversion (Server) Windows Server 2003 [nur Desktop-Apps]
Zielplattform Windows
Kopfzeile shlobj_core.h